Camphor burl
From a fairly small street tree, this huge burl grew like an upside down mushroom. Total height of less than a foot, the tree trunk was a fifth the diameter of the burl. This is the smallest piece around 3' across, the biggest is almost 5' in diameter.


Our favorite way to work
Our favorite way to work even on projects we didn’t design is to be involved at the end of construction or the beginning of a home purchase for an intense month where we might make a dozen critical pieces of what will make your home special. we save the effort for the parts you see every day: doors, light fixtures, key pieces of furniture, cabinets.
